The nanophotonics market is experiencing significant growth due to its potential applications in various industries, including telecommunications, healthcare, energy, and consumer electronics. Nanophotonics involves the use of nanotechnology to manipulate light on the nanometer scale, enabling advancements in areas such as optical communication, imaging systems, and solar energy. The demand for high-speed data transmission and miniaturized devices has accelerated the need for nanophotonic components such as optical fibers, lasers, and sensors. Recent developments include innovations in quantum dot-based displays and photonic crystal structures, which promise to improve efficiency and performance. Companies are increasingly focusing on research and development to enhance light manipulation capabilities and integrate nanophotonic solutions into consumer products. As the technology continues to mature, the market is expected to grow rapidly, driven by the increasing adoption of nanophotonics in key sectors. These advancements position nanophotonics as a crucial element in next-generation optical and electronic systems.
